Happy to second this.


When we moved in around five years ago, they carpeted our flat throughout. Great selection of carpets and underlays, reasonably priced. Offered an appointment within a few days to measure up and quote and when we placed the order they were happy to hold the carpet in storage for several months while we had some plastering, redecoration, etc. done. When we were ready for them to fit the carpets, it was easy to arrange a mutually convenient date and they fitted the carpet to a very high standard with the minimum of fuss and inconvenience.


We've recently decided to have the bathroom fitted with new flooring and they were our first - and only! - port of call. Again, excellent service from the moment we walked through the door. They've just levelled the floor for us and we're waiting for the new flooring to be laid on Monday. Excellent job so far and no doubts that the eventual finish will be superb.
